(often found in compressed archive formats like .7z for distribution) is a physics-based, 17th-century sword-fighting simulator that prioritizes historical accuracy and lethal realism over traditional "health bar" fighting mechanics [10]. Developed by a small team (primarily Kubold , an experienced animator), the game utilizes high-fidelity motion capture and active ragdoll physics to create one of the most technical fencing experiences available on PC [1, 7].
